Obama Backs FBI Probe Into Hillary Clinton's Emails

The White House may just have just hammered the final nail in Hillary Clinton’s campaign coffin.

During a White House briefing with reporters, Press Secretary Josh Earnest dispelled the Democratic Party talking point that FBI Director James Comey new criminal probe into Hillary Clinton’s email server scandal was politically motivated.

Earnest told reporters that Director Comey was  “a man of integrity” and of “principle,” adding that President Obama didn’t believe that his motives were not to “influence the outcome of an election,” or that he is “secretly strategizing to benefit one candidate or one political party.”

Comey, a registered Republican, first drew fire from Republicans and praise from Democrats when he a

nnounced that the FBI would not pursue criminal charges against Clinton for passing along classified emails from her private email server.
